Stone wall hardscaping services involve the construction and installation of durable, aesthetically appealing walls using natural or manufactured stone materials. These services typically include designing, sourcing materials, and building walls that serve both functional and decorative purposes. Stone walls can be tailored to complement various landscape styles, offering a timeless look that enhances the overall appearance of residential, commercial, or public properties. Skilled contractors ensure that each wall is constructed with attention to detail, stability, and longevity, making them suitable for a variety of outdoor settings.

One of the primary problems stone wall hardscaping addresses is soil erosion and land stability. In areas with uneven terrain, stone walls can act as retaining walls, preventing soil from shifting or washing away during heavy rains. Additionally, these walls can serve as boundary markers, providing privacy and defining property lines in a visually appealing manner. For properties that require a sturdy barrier or a decorative feature, stone walls offer a natural solution that combines utility with aesthetic appeal. They also help in reducing maintenance needs compared to other fencing or wall materials, making them a practical choice for long-term outdoor planning.

Properties that typically utilize stone wall hardscaping services include residential homes with landscaped yards, farms, and estates that require terracing or land management solutions. Commercial properties such as restaurants, retail centers, and office complexes often incorporate stone walls to create inviting outdoor spaces or to delineate different areas within the property. Public parks and community spaces also benefit from stone walls, which provide durable seating, edging for pathways, or protective barriers around plantings and features. The versatility of stone walls allows them to be integrated into a wide range of property types, enhancing both function and visual appeal.

Material Costs - Stone wall materials typically range from $15 to $50 per square foot, depending on the type of stone used. For example, natural limestone may cost around $20 per square foot, while high-end granite can be closer to $45. These costs are for the materials only and do not include installation.

Labor Expenses - Installation costs for stone walls generally fall between $30 and $80 per hour, with total project costs varying based on size and complexity. A small retaining wall might cost around $1,500, while larger, intricate designs can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.

Project Size Impact - The overall cost of stone wall services depends heavily on the project's size and scope. A simple garden border might cost under $1,000, whereas a full retaining wall for a hillside could range from $5,000 to over $20,000. Contact local service providers for tailored estimates.

Additional Factors - Factors such as site preparation, foundation work, and design complexity can influence costs. For example, grading and excavation might add $500 to $2,000 to the total project. Local pros can assess site-specific needs to determine accurate pricing.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a stone wall hardscaping professional, it is important to consider the experience of the local contractors. Experienced providers typically have a solid understanding of different stone types, structural techniques, and design principles, which can contribute to a durable and aesthetically pleasing result. Homeowners are encouraged to inquire about the length of time a contractor has been working in the area and their familiarity with local conditions, as this can impact the success of the project.

Clear and written expectations are essential for a smooth project process. Reputable local pros often provide det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and estimated timelines. This transparency helps homeowners understand what to expect and reduces the likelihood of misunderstandings. Asking for a written plan or contract can serve as a reference throughout the project, ensuring that all parties are aligned on the goals and deliverables.

Reputation and communication are key factors when comparing local stone wall hardscaping providers. Homeowners should seek out references or reviews from previous clients to gauge the quality of work and professionalism. Good communication involves timely responses to inquiries, clarity in explanations, and a willingness to address questions or concerns. Choosing a contractor who maintains open and consistent communication can contribute to a more positive and predictable project experience.
